Ochsner BR Welcomes New Medical Staff Members

Several new members across various specialties have recently joined Ochsner. They include:

Susan McNamara, M.D., is board-certified in internal medicine and a primary care physician who recently transferred to Ochsner 65 Plus – Bocage. She has been on staff at Ochsner since 2000. McNamara earned a medical degree from the Tulane University School of Medicine and completed an internship and residency at Ochsner Medical Center.

 

 

 

 

 

 

Kate Freeman, M.D., practices family medicine at Ochsner 65 Plus – Bocage. Freeman earned a medical degree from the LSU Health School of Medicine in Shreveport and completed the Family Medicine Residency Program at Baton Rouge General Medical Center. She is board-certified by the American Board of Family Medicine and certified by the Hospice Medical Director Certification Board. She is a diplomate of the American Board of Integrative and Holistic Medicine and a member of the American Academy of Family Physicians, Louisiana Academy of Family Physicians, and Louisiana State Medical Society.

 

 

 

 

Kantha Kolla, M.D., is a hospitalist at Ochsner Medical Center – Baton Rouge. Kolla earned a medical degree from GSL Medical College in India. She completed a master’s degree in public health from the Tulane University School of Public Health and Tropical Medicine in New Orleans. She completed an internship and residency at the University of Maryland Capital Region Health (formerly known as Prince George Hospital Center) in Largo, Md. Kolla is board-certified by American Board of Internal Medicine.

Amy Copeland, Ph.D. M.P., is a medical psychologist at Ochsner Health Center – O’Neal. She provides psychiatric evaluations and medication management to adults with a variety of mood, anxiety, substance use, trauma-related, and eating disorders, as well as adults with ADHD. Copeland earned an undergraduate degree in psychology from the University of California, San Diego. She earned a master's degree and doctorate in clinical psychology from State University of New York at Binghamton. She completed a clinical internship at the University of California San Francisco, followed by a postdoctoral fellowship in public service and minority mental health with a specialization in substance abuse and HIV. Copeland also completed a postdoctoral master's degree in clinical psychopharmacology and is licensed to prescribe psychiatric medication. Her professional memberships include Association for Behavioral and Cognitive Therapies, American Psychological Association, College on Problems of Drug Dependence, and Society for Research on Nicotine and Tobacco.

 

 

 

Allis Armato, PA-C, assists in colorectal surgeries at Ochsner Medical Center – Baton Rouge and sees patients at Ochsner Cancer Center – Baton Rouge. Armato earned a master’s degree physician assistant studies from LSU Health Sciences Center in Shreveport. She is a member of the American Academy of Physician Assistants and the Louisiana Academy of Physician Assistants.

 

 

 

 

 

 

Ashley Carline, NP, is part of the OB/GYN staff at Ochsner Medical Center – Baton Rouge and Ochsner Medical Complex – The Grove. Carline earned a bachelor’s degree from Louisiana Tech University in Ruston and a bachelor’s degree in nursing from Franciscan Missionaries of Our Lady University. She also completed a master’s degree in family nursing from the University of South Alabama in Mobile, Ala. 

 

 

 

 

 

 

Brittany Draper, NP, is a board-certified nurse practitioner at Ochsner Medical Center – Baton Rouge. Draper earned a bachelor’s degree in nursing from Southeastern Louisiana University in Hammond and a master’s degree in nursing from the University of Texas Health & Science Center at Houston.
